cmake_minimum_required(VERSION 2.8) project(ChangeLog) set( C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-std=c++14 -W -Wall -Wextra -Winline -ldl -fPIC" ) include_directories( src/ ) add_library( ChangeLog SHARED src/change_log.cc src/init/alloc.cc src/utility/logger.cc src/tracking/path_matcher.cc src/tracking/change_tracker.cc ) target_link_libraries( ChangeLog boost_system boost_filesystem ) install( PROGRAMS change DESTINATION bin ) install( TARGETS ChangeLog LIBRARY DESTINATION lib )